Transaction ed50513a32ffb1677d638cc2b617fc3b83d770c7955daa1a07ddde14a2d8b208
1 Input
1 Output
-
ed50513a32ffb1677d638cc2b617fc3b83d770c7955daa1a07ddde14a2d8b208:0
- value
- 585539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52158ae77e4c95896a0b56ea8eb7e761da80f865 OP_EQUAL
- address
- 39B395ZwwbZ7s1kMdjRvEBXJBdiBHz3Jk3